Chinese Bamboo Tree


This fable illustrates the value of persistence.

You take a little seed, plant it, water it, and fertilize it for a whole year, and nothing happens.

The second year you water and fertilize it, and nothing happens.

The third year you water it and fertilize it, and nothing happens. How discouraging this becomes!

The fourth year you water it and fertilize it, and nothing happens. This is very frustrating.

The fifth year you continue to water and fertilize the seed and then sometime during the fifth year, the Chinese bamboo tree sprouts and grows ninety feet in six weeks!
